Broad development of solar power in Greece started in the 2000s, with installations of photovoltaic systems skyrocketing from 2009 because of the appealing feed-in tariffs introduced and the corresponding regulations for domestic applications of rooftop solar PV. Greece is in the midst of a significant solar energy boom, with its solar PV pipeline projected to reach an impressive 44.8 GW by 2028, according to Fitch Solutions.
